My FHD screen is just a touch too small to be comfortable at native resolution, while 1.5x makes things too big. Also, I find Firefox's built-in scaling to be much better quality than scaling using Gnome. It could be better exposed; the `layout.css.devPixelsPerPx` property in about:config is what you need to tweak. So I keep Gnome at 1.0x, and Firefox at 1.25x, which as an extra bonus means that "80%" scaling takes F…

In these cases, what I've found to work quite well is to not bother with scaling at all for Gnome, but rather up the font sizes in the tweak tool and scale Firefox individually :) Seems to work out rather well.

Does Gnome under X11 allow you to set the desktop's size higher than the screen resolution and scale that down? Because that's all Apple's "fractional" scaling does-- macOS only supports integer scaling (specifically, 1x and 2x; iOS does 3x but not macOS); the "more space" scaling settings just render the screen at a resolution higher than the physical size of the panel and scale it to fit (for example, current 15" M…

PSA: there's fractional scaling for text even with Xorg, and most applications scale their UI accordingly. I like to set Gnome's full scaling to 1 and text scaling to 1.5. gsettings set org.gnome.desktop.interface scaling-factor 1 gsettings set org.gnome.desktop.interface text-scaling-factor 1.5 Some applications also depend on Xft and X root window DPI. .Xresources: Xft.dpi: 144 Xft.hinting: 1 Xft.hintstyle: hintsli…

Do you happen to know by chance what scaling algorithm is used?

The GPU does the downscaling, I think it's bicubic by default. Looks decent enough.

With the latest xrandr master, you can set nearest-neighbor using "--filter nearest", which should provide better results.

> Does Gnome under X11 allow you to set the desktop's size higher than the screen resolution and scale that down? FWIW, this is possible under X11 directly. Try running: xrandr --scale 2x2

I tried that and it said you need to specify an output.

    xrandr --scale 2x2 --output OUTPUT
where OUTPUT will vary depending on what screens you actually have, but will usually be something like LVDS1 or VGA1. You can get the possible values with auto-completion in Bash (on Debian at least) or by running just xrandr.

Do you happen to know by chance what scaling algorithm is used?

The GPU does the downscaling, I think it's bicubic by default. Looks decent enough. With the latest xrandr master, you can set nearest-neighbor using "--filter nearest", which should provide better results.

At least on macOS and X11/xrandr --scale, the output encoder does the scaling, not the GPU. It need less energy to do that, than spinning up the GPU, and the all GPU resources are available to the applications (scaling entire framebuffer at 60 Hz would take significant memory bandwidth from GPU at least).
